Understanding the Core Question: What Is a Typical Clutch Life?
A typical clutch lasts about 60,000 to 100,000 miles, depending on usage and maintenance. When you keep your clutch in good health by following routine checks, you’ll likely reach the upper end of that range. However, if you’re a heavy commuter who keeps gears swirling, you may see the life curve dip toward the lower end.

Driving Habits That Test Your Clutch
Every clutch has limits, and it’s your day‑to‑day driving that can push those limits to breaking point.
- Frequent hill starts swing the clutch harder!
- Idling in traffic with the clutch partially engaged accelerates wear.
- Shift too quickly from low to high gears—your clutch wears faster.
To avoid those pitfalls, adopt these practical habits:
- Use parking brake on steep inclines.
- Throttle gently, aiming for smooth gear changes.
- Depress the clutch fully before shifting to higher gears.
